

Mrs. Mildred Helen Biondolillo of Canton, Georgia passed away January 5, 2015. She was born on February 27, 1923, in Norwich, CT to the late William and Mary Mulcahy. She graduated from Norwich Free Academy, where she lettered in volley ball. Mildred married Samuel Biondolillo, a WWII veteran, and then they started their family. Samuel worked for Dow Chemical Company as an International Marine Manager. During his career they lived in Norwich, CT, Midland, MI and Huston, Texas. Upon retirement, they relocated to Beverly Hills, Florida, and have spent the past ten years in Canton, GA. For many years, Mildred worked for American Heart Association in Norwich, CT. She was a loving and devoted wife, mother and homemaker. She enjoyed golfing, bowling, puzzles, dancing, gardening, traveling and making her famous spaghetti and meatballs. She also liked watching sports and spending time at the ocean with family and friends. Mildred was preceded in death by her parents, sisters, Marguerite and Annamae, brother, James and grandson, Nathan. She is survived by her husband of 70 years, Samuel Russell Biondolillo, sons, Jim Biondolillo (Michele) and David Bionsolillo (Joyce), daughter, Donna Shepherd (Douglas), grandchildren, Nic, John, Andy, Dawn and Brian, 7 great-grandchildren and one great-great grandchild.
